Question
If the distance between two masses be doubled, then the force between will become:
✓
Answer
(a) $\frac{1}{4}$times Explaination : $
F_g=G \frac{m_1 m_2}{r^2}
$
Therefore, $F _{ g } \propto \frac{1}{ r ^2}$
Hence, if the distance between the bodies is doubled, the gravitational force of attraction becomes one-fourth.
